Ingredients

  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 large onion, very thinly sliced
  • - olive oil, as needed
  • 1 jar vodka sauce (prego 24 ozs)
  • 1 box swanson chicken broth (32 ozs)
  • 1 can 10 oz chicken, drained & cubed
  • 2 cups farfalle pasta, cooked according to directions
  • 1 cup whole milk
  • - parmesan cheese
  • - salt and cracked pepper

How To Make drunken chicken soup

  • Step 1
    Start with a little olive oil in bottom of soup pot, add minced garlic & thinly sliced onion. Saute till soft. Onion translucent.
  • Step 2
    Meanwhile in another pot cook farfalle according to package directions.
  • Step 3
    Drain canned chicken, chop coarsely. Add to pot with onions & garlic. Heat, let brown slightly. Salt & pepper to taste.
  • Step 4
    Add the chicken broth. Add jar of Vodka sauce, and 1 cup milk. Drain, pasta and add to pot. Let it gently warm through, scoop up into individual bowls. Top with parm & more cracked sea salt & cracked pepper as desired. Enjoy!
